Overview
The Ubiquiti USW-MISSION-CRITICAL (MPN: USW-MISSION-CRITICAL) is a 1U rack-mount UniFi network switch engineered for critical infrastructure deployments requiring high availability and deterministic performance. This nine-port Gigabit switch delivers 18 Gbps switching capacity with 9 Gbps non-blocking throughput and a 13 Mpps forwarding rate, supporting mission-critical applications where packet loss and latency must be minimized. Built with SGCC steel construction, the switch operates reliably across -5 to 40°C and includes NDAA compliance certification, making it suitable for government and defense infrastructure projects.
Key Features
The USW-MISSION-CRITICAL provides robust Layer 2 switching with support for up to 1,000 VLANs, enabling sophisticated network segmentation in complex enterprise environments. The switch accepts universal AC input (100–240V, 50/60 Hz) with an internal 240W power supply and draws only 50W during normal operation, making it efficient for continuous deployment in network closets and data centers. It delivers 120W of PoE budget across its nine ports, allowing simultaneous powered device operation without external injectors. Ethernet-based management integrates seamlessly into UniFi controller deployments, providing centralized monitoring and configuration alongside other UniFi infrastructure.
Deployment Scenarios
This switch is optimized for access-layer deployments in enterprise campuses, industrial networks, and telecommunications facilities where uptime is non-negotiable. The non-blocking throughput and low forwarding latency suit real-time applications including VoIP systems, industrial IoT networks, and video surveillance backhaul. Its VLAN capability supports multi-tenant environments and network isolation requirements common in healthcare, financial services, and critical infrastructure. The compact 442 × 480 × 44 mm footprint integrates into standard 19-inch racks without requiring additional vertical space.
Network Integration
The Ubiquiti USW-MISSION-CRITICAL functions as a managed access switch within UniFi ecosystem deployments. Nine Gigabit Ethernet ports operate at 1G/100M/10M speed negotiation, accommodating legacy equipment while supporting modern high-speed endpoints. Management occurs through standard Ethernet connectivity to a UniFi controller, eliminating the need for dedicated serial console or out-of-band access channels. The switch's VLAN support enables integration into multi-site networks where traffic isolation and QoS policies must follow enterprise security frameworks.
Installation Notes
The switch weighs 9 kg (19.9 lb) and ships with SGCC steel mounting hardware for standard rack installation. Universal voltage input accommodates both North American and international facilities without power supply reconfiguration. Certifications include CE, FCC, IC, and Anatel (06679-25-08356), confirming regulatory compliance across major markets. Operators should verify available rack power capacity supports the 240W internal supply, particularly in environments with existing thermal constraints or power distribution limitations.
